Overview
Old Wendell Road Falls is a small, lightly-documented cascade along Old Wendell Road in Northfield, in the stretch that cuts south through state-forest land near Pauchaug Brook drainage. There is no developed trailhead; local visitors pull off on the dirt shoulder and scramble a few feet to the brook. Flow is seasonal and thins out by mid-summer.

Getting there
Use Old Wendell Road in Northfield; the cascade is along a brook crossing south of the village. There is no signed trailhead — look for a dirt shoulder wide enough to park and a short herd path down to the water.
